BOSC uses the latest in Gallium Nitride (GaN) technology to achieve high performance in a small form factor.
The low on resistance and low capacitance of the GaN FET enables high efficiency and lowers loop impedance for low Transient Intermodulation Distortion (T-IMD). The fast switching capability and zero reverse recovery charge enable higher output linearity and low cross over distortion for lower Total Harmonic Distortion (THD).
Preliminary Specifications:
- Gain: 16.8dB or 6.92
- Signal to Noise Ratio (SNR): ~120dB
- Total Harmonic Distortion (THD): <0.0006% (-105dB) @ 5W
- Frequency Response: DC - 40kHz
- Sensitivity: 2.5Vin for 37.5W into 8Ω
- Input Impedance: 5kΩ fully balanced
- Output Power: 100W into 8Ω w/ 48V Power Supply
- Output Power: 150W into 8Ω w/ 56V Power Supply
- Size: 5.5" (14cm) x 4.8" (12.2cm) x 1.9" (4.8cm)

BOSC quality...
Every BOSC amp is hand-assembled and tested in the USA, by yours truly.
The circuit board (PCB) uses a high-quality dielectric, has a gold finish (ENIG), and is assembled in Eatontown, NJ.
The components all come from high-end semiconductor manufacturers: Texas Instruments; Analog Devices; Murata; Panasonic; and NXP; to name a few.
The output filter inductors use oxygen-free copper (OFC) and are specifically made for Class-D amplifiers.
